3. Fleming's Left-Hand Rule (for motors)

Mnemonic: "Father Made Rice"

  • F = Force (Thumb)
  • M = Magnetic field (Index finger)
  • R = Current (Middle finger)

This helps you remember the directions of Force, Magnetic field, and Current for motor action.

4. Right-Hand Thumb Rule 

Mnemonic: "Grip the Current"

  • Thumb = Direction of Current
  • Fingers = Curl around to show the direction of the Magnetic field

This mnemonic helps you visualize the right-hand thumb rule to determine the direction of the magnetic field.
